Saudi-led ‘friendly fire’ air strike kills dozens of militants in Jawf

JAWF, March 14 (YPA) -More than 30 militants loyal to Saudi-led coalition forces have been killed and wounded on Thursday in a friendly fire accident in Jawf province, northern Yemen, a military source told Yemen Press Agency.

According to the source, the Saudi-led coalition waged an air strike on gatherings of their own mercenaries at the Rabaa mountain of Bart Al Anan District in the northern part of Jawf province, leaving heavy casualties in their ranks.

This painful incident is not the first of its kind.

This time, the attack coincided with massive expulsions of mercenaries from the border fronts into the Jawf desert, Wadeiah, Ma’rib, as well as several campaigns of arrests and abductions of pro-Saudi mercenary leaders.
